Why Fast Incident Recovery Matters for DevOps and SRE

Minimizing Mean Time to Recovery (MTTR) is a primary goal for any high-performing engineering organization. A faster, more organized response delivers crucial benefits that extend far beyond the technical issue itself.

  • Reduces Business Impact: Shorter incidents mean less disruption to customers and lower revenue loss. For many businesses, unplanned downtime can cost thousands or even millions of dollars per hour [2].
  • Improves Team Morale: Efficient processes and clear tooling reduce the stress placed on on-call engineers. This helps prevent the burnout and alert fatigue that plague teams facing manual, chaotic responses [6].
  • Builds Customer Trust: A rapid, organized, and transparent response demonstrates preparedness and competence, strengthening customer confidence in your services.
  • Creates Learning Opportunities: A structured incident process enables better retrospectives, turning failures into valuable lessons for improving system resilience [7].

Key Features of Modern Incident Management Software

Before choosing a platform, you need to know what capabilities matter most. The best modern incident management software shares a common set of powerful features designed to automate and streamline the entire response workflow.

  • Automated Alerting & On-Call Scheduling: Routes alerts from monitoring systems directly to the right person at the right time. Look for flexible scheduling, escalation policies, and overrides to ensure critical alerts are never missed.
  • Centralized Communication: Automatically creates a dedicated command center—often a Slack or Microsoft Teams channel—for each incident. This brings responders, stakeholders, and relevant data together in one place, eliminating confusion.
  • Workflow Automation: Automates repetitive tasks to save valuable time during a crisis. This includes creating a war room, pulling in monitoring dashboards, starting a video conference, and generating a retrospective document [8].
  • Seamless Integrations: Connects with your team's existing tech stack, from monitoring tools like Datadog and version control like GitHub to ticketing systems like Jira. Strong integrations are essential for building a cohesive sre observability stack for kubernetes and other complex environments [4].
  • Retrospectives & Reporting: Helps teams analyze incident data, automatically document timelines, identify root causes, and track action items to prevent future occurrences.
  • Status Pages: Communicates incident status transparently with both internal stakeholders and external customers.

PagerDuty

PagerDuty is a long-standing leader in on-call management and alerting [1]. It's well-known for its robust and reliable alerting capabilities, making it a common starting point for teams looking to formalize their initial incident response process.

  • Key Features: PagerDuty excels at reliable on-call scheduling and multi-channel alerting via SMS, push notifications, phone calls, and email. Its event intelligence features help group and suppress noisy alerts, and it offers a broad ecosystem of integrations.

Opsgenie

Opsgenie is Atlassian's on-call and alert management solution, now part of Jira Service Management. It's a strong choice for teams already embedded in the Atlassian ecosystem (Jira, Confluence, Bitbucket).

  • Key Features: Opsgenie’s primary strength is its seamless integration with Jira, which creates a unified workflow for IT Service Management (ITSM) and incident response. It provides flexible rules for routing alerts and includes reporting on team and on-call performance.

Jira Service Management

Jira Service Management extends the power of Jira to operations teams, combining traditional ITSM with modern incident management practices. It’s a platform designed to bridge the gap between development and IT operations for better visibility and collaboration.

  • Key Features: It leverages Opsgenie for alerting and on-call management. By connecting development work in Jira Software with operations incidents, it provides better context for resolving issues tied to recent deployments. The platform also includes features for change management and asset management.

How to Choose the Right Tool for Your SRE Team

Selecting the right tool depends on your team's specific needs, maturity, and existing technology stack. To make the best choice, ask these critical questions.

  • Assess Your Maturity: Are you just formalizing your first on-call rotation, or are you managing complex services where automated, end-to-end response is non-negotiable? A simple alerting tool might suffice for a small team, while a larger organization will benefit from a full-lifecycle platform like Rootly.
  • Evaluate Your Existing Stack: The best tool integrates seamlessly with the software you already use [3]. Map out your critical tools for monitoring, communication, and project management, and prioritize platforms with deep, native integrations.
  • Focus on Automation: Manual toil is a direct contributor to longer MTTR and engineer burnout. Prioritize platforms that automate repetitive tasks, as this is one of the most effective ways to cut down on incident response time.
  • Consider the Entire Lifecycle: Don't just focus on alerting. The best tools for on-call engineers also provide powerful capabilities for collaboration during an incident and, just as importantly, for learning after it's resolved.
